Today we have a full slate of games so let’s see what we can find to wager on. *PAPA DUDE BEST BET OF THE DAY*: New Orleans 14-25 vs. Toronto 19-17 (-8.5): The Raptors have won five in a row and are healthy coming into this one. They have won at Milwaukee and dominated Utah in their last two outings. The Pelicans are coming off an impressive win over Golden State and are improving everyday after a horrible start. I’m a little worried about a Toronto letdown, and the line is a somewhat out of my comfort zone, but the Raptors should cover. Toronto 118 New Orleans 105 PAPA DUDES PICK: Toronto -8.5 Moneyline Bets: San Antonio 15-23 at Brooklyn 24-13 (-11): The Nets are in a funk and have lost 4 out of the last 5.
